In the bustling streets of Manhattan, Kiden Nixon navigates a world filled with challenges and dangers, but her extraordinary mutant abilities set her apart. Struggling to find her place, she grapples with the complexities of her life as a young mutant, seeking comfort and belonging amidst turmoil. The city can be both a refuge and a battleground, and for Kiden, it's a constant fight for survival.
As she delves deeper into her journey, she discovers that home is not merely a physical location but an emotional refuge shaped by relationships and experiences. With each encounter, Kiden learns more about herself and the powers she possesses, uncovering the strength required to face the world that fears her. With her unique perspective, the possibility of forging her own path becomes evident, urging her to embrace her identity and redefine what home truly means.
